Beschreibung

Aboriginal Resistance challenges the conventional narrative of Australian history by highlighting the active and diverse ways Aboriginal Australians resisted colonial oppression. Rather than being passive victims, Aboriginal people engaged in armed conflicts, cultural preservation, and political activism to assert their sovereignty. The book explores how Aboriginal Australians strategically fought frontier wars and simultaneously maintained their languages and kinship systems, defying assimilation policies.

 
The book examines Aboriginal resistance within the context of European colonialism and its global impact, emphasizing the enduring fight for self-determination and justice. By drawing on historical documents, oral histories, and ethnographic studies, the author centers Aboriginal voices and perspectives, revealing the biases present in colonial records.

 
The narrative progresses through key themes, starting with the concept of resistance itself, then exploring armed conflicts, cultural preservation, and political activism, culminating in a discussion of contemporary implications. This comprehensive account offers a unique perspective by focusing on Aboriginal agency, making it valuable to students, scholars, and anyone interested in Australian history, Indigenous studies, and social justice.

 
Ultimately, understanding this history is crucial for addressing ongoing issues of inequality and advancing reconciliation efforts in Australia.

    World War II was the largest and most violent armed conflict in the history of mankind. Highly relevant today, World War II has much to teach us, not only about the profession of arms, but also about military preparedness, global strategy, and combined operations in the coalition war against fascism. This book follows military operations in Italy from 5 April to 8 May 1945. 
    The Allies had begun their invasion of the Italian mainland in early September 1943 with the promise of a quick drive north, up the "soft underbelly" of Europe and into the German heartland. Yet nineteen months later, after hard fighting up the rugged mountainous spine of the narrow Italian peninsula, such goals still eluded the Anglo-American military leaders of the Mediterranean Theater. To be sure, long before April 1945 Rome had fallen to Allied arms and fascist Italy had been knocked almost completely out of the war. But in the interval France had also been liberated, and the Soviet Union had reclaimed almost all of its territory previously conquered by the once invincible German war machine.
    Italy had in fact become a sideshow, a secondary theater, since the spring of 1944 when the western Allies had shifted their military resources north to support the buildup and execution of Operation OVERLORD, the invasion of Normandy. After that, there had been no turning back on the Anglo-American side, with its main effort directed east through the northern European plains. Thus, by April Germany was besieged on three sides, although the Allied forces in the south, those strung out along the northern Apennines overlooking the Po Valley, were now the farthest away from the tottering Third Reich. British Prime Minister Winston Churchill continued to strongly support an advance from northern Italy into the Balkans and southern Germany. However, the ability of the Italian-based Allied armies to sustain such an effort with minimal support in men and materiel seemed problematic…

    Thomas D'Arcy McGee was an Irish refugee and a father of the Canadian confederation. His work on Irish history is comprehensive, encompassing twelve books; Book 2 begins with the Norse or Danish invasion of the island and continues through the end of the Viking period. (Summary by Sibella Denton)

    Psychological safety—the belief that you can speak up without risk of punishment or humiliation—is crucial for high-performing teams and innovative organizations. This revised and expanded edition of Timothy Clark's groundbreaking framework provides leaders with a research-backed roadmap through four distinct stages that enable individuals to feel safe, valued, and empowered.The four stages build progressively: Inclusion Safety (feeling included and accepted), Learner Safety (feeling safe to learn and ask questions), Contributor Safety (feeling safe to contribute and participate), and Challenger Safety (feeling safe to challenge the status quo and speak truth to power). 
    This new edition adds compelling quantitative evidence from Clark's global database of 1.2 million data points, validating the four-stage model across cultures and demographics. New chapters explore what psychological safety is not, the dangers of "nice" cultures, the relationship between psychological and physical safety, and practical measurement strategies.Leaders will learn to banish fear, create performance-based accountability, and build environments where people thrive beyond expectations.
